3 members of family among 4 killed in Kishtwar accident
Ramban, Dec 6: In a heartbreaking incident, four pilgrims, including three members of a family, from the Dessa area of Doda district lost their lives after a private vehicle skidded off a link road and plunged into a deep gorge in Sarthal Gurash area in Kishtwar district on Saturday afternoon.
According to officials, the ill-fated light vehicle, bearing registration number DL5CE-5634, was enroute to Dessa from the Sarthal Devi temple when the driver reportedly lost control, causing the vehicle to roll down into the gorge.
Three occupants died on the spot, while the fourth, who was critically injured, was shifted to District Hospital Kishtwar, where she succumbed to her injuries.
The deceased were identified as Ranjeet Singh (37), son of Puran Chand; his minor daughter Asu; and Simran Thakur (21), daughter of Om Prakash—all residents of Thata, Dessa in Doda district. The fourth victim, Jyoti Devi (35), wife of Ranjeet Singh was rescued in critical condition but later declared dead at the hospital.
Sources said the victims were part of a group of around 30 pilgrims from Dessa who had set out to pay obeisance at Sarthal Mata temple.
Meanwhile, Union Minister Dr Jitendra Singh expressed grief over the incident on social media platform X, stating that he had spoken to Deputy Commissioner Kishtwar, Pankaj Kumar Sharma, following the tragedy. “Saddened to learn about the tragic road accident on Sarthal road in which four occupants of the vehicle, hailing from Marmat area, unfortunately lost their life. My deepest condolences to the bereaved families,” he posted.
Authorities have initiated further investigation into the cause of the accident.
